Overview

A load runner is an essential tool in industrial testing, designed to simulate real-world operational loads on machinery. It helps manufacturers evaluate the durability, efficiency, and performance of mechanical systems before deployment. These devices are widely used in automotive, aerospace, and heavy machinery industries. Load runners come in various configurations, including hydraulic, electric, and mechanical models. They are engineered to provide precise control over load conditions, enabling accurate performance analysis. Structure and Working Principle

A typical load runner consists of a load application unit, control system, and data acquisition module. The load application unit applies force or torque to the test subject, while the control system adjusts parameters like speed and load magnitude. The working principle involves mimicking operational stresses, such as variable loads and cyclic forces, to assess how the machinery responds. Advanced models incorporate real-time feedback mechanisms to adjust loads dynamically, ensuring accurate simulation of real-world conditions.

Key Features

Modern load runners offer features like programmable load profiles, high-precision sensors, and remote monitoring capabilities. These features enable comprehensive testing under diverse conditions. Durability and adaptability are critical, as load runners must withstand prolonged use without performance degradation. Some models also include integrated software for data analysis, simplifying the interpretation of test results.

Application Areas

Load runners are indispensable in industries requiring rigorous testing, such as automotive (engine and transmission testing), aerospace (component durability), and manufacturing (quality assurance). They are also used in research and development to validate new designs and materials. By simulating extreme conditions, load runners help identify potential failures before mass production, saving costs and improving safety.

Maintenance and Precautions

Regular maintenance is crucial to ensure the accuracy and longevity of load runners. This includes calibration checks, lubrication of moving parts, and inspection of sensors and control systems. Operators should adhere to manufacturer guidelines to avoid overloading or misuse, which can damage the equipment. Proper training is essential to maximize the device's capabilities and ensure safe operation.

B2B Procurement Guide

When procuring a load runner, consider factors like load capacity, compatibility with existing systems, and after-sales support. Customizable options may be necessary for specialized applications. Evaluate suppliers based on reputation, technical support, and warranty terms. Request demonstrations or case studies to verify performance claims. Budget should balance initial costs with long-term reliability and maintenance needs.
